Nature's Retreat in Chikmagalur

Viewed by 68 travelers
Day 1 · Thu, Dec 14
Chikmagalur, India · Thursday, December 14, 2023

Tranquil Mornings

  • Baba Budangiri Sunrise Trek (INR 500 · 3 hours)
  • Manikyadhara Falls Visit (INR 100 · 1.5 hours)
  • Chennakeshava Temple Visit (INR 200 · 2 hours)
  • Coffee Estate Tour (INR 300 · 2 hours)

Morning:

Start your day with a breathtaking sunrise trek to the peak of Baba Budangiri Hills. Experience the serenity of the surroundings and marvel at the panoramic views of the Western Ghats. Afterward, visit the Manikyadhara Falls for a refreshing nature walk amidst lush greenery.

Afternoon:

Head to Belur to explore the iconic Chennakeshava Temple, a masterpiece of Hoysala architecture. Immerse yourself in the intricate carvings and historical significance of this ancient temple.

Evening:

Spend your evening at a local coffee estate for a guided tour. Learn about the coffee-making process, stroll through the plantations, and savor freshly brewed coffee as you soak in the tranquil ambiance.

Day 2 · Fri, Dec 15
Chikmagalur, India · Friday, December 15, 2023

Misty Mountains and Lakes

  • Mullayanagiri Peak Hike (INR 300 · 4 hours)
  • Deviramma Temple Visit (Free · 1 hour)
  • Kudremukh National Park Nature Walk (INR 200 · 2 hours)
  • Hebbe Falls Visit (INR 100 · 1.5 hours)

Morning:

Embark on a picturesque hike to Mullayanagiri Peak, the highest peak in Karnataka. Feel the misty mountain breeze and revel in the awe-inspiring views of the verdant valleys. Afterward, visit the serene Deviramma Temple nestled amidst the serene surroundings of the mountains.

Afternoon:

Explore the biodiversity of Kudremukh National Park with a guided nature walk. Encounter diverse flora and fauna, listen to the symphony of birds, and breathe in the pure air of the Western Ghats.

Evening:

Conclude your day with a visit to Hebbe Falls, where you can witness the mesmerizing sunset amidst the cascading waterfalls and lush evergreen forests.

Day 3 · Sat, Dec 16
Chikmagalur, India · Saturday, December 16, 2023

Coffee Trail and Cultural Heritage

  • Coffee Museum Visit (INR 150 · 1.5 hours)
  • Halebidu Temple Ruins Exploration (INR 250 · 2 hours)
  • Bhadra Wildlife Sanctuary Jeep Safari (INR 1000 · 3 hours)
  • Cultural Dance Performance (INR 300 · 2 hours)

Morning:

Start your day with a visit to the Coffee Museum, where you can delve into the history and art of coffee-making in Chikmagalur. Learn about the legacy of coffee cultivation and its impact on the region. Then, explore the historic ruins of the Halebidu Temple, renowned for its exquisite Hoysala architecture and intricate sculptures.

Afternoon:

Embark on a thrilling jeep safari in the Bhadra Wildlife Sanctuary to spot diverse wildlife such as elephants, leopards, and rare bird species. Immerse yourself in the untamed beauty of the sanctuary as you traverse through the dense forests and grasslands.

Evening:

Spend your evening experiencing a traditional dance performance showcasing the rich cultural heritage of Karnataka. Indulge in local delicacies and immerse yourself in the vibrant rhythms and colorful expressions of the traditional art forms.

Day 4 · Sun, Dec 17
Chikmagalur, India · Sunday, December 17, 2023

Sunrise Yoga and Ethereal Lakes

  • Sunrise Yoga Session (Free · 1.5 hours)
  • Bhadra Dam Boat Ride (INR 300 · 2 hours)
  • Tea Estate Visit (INR 200 · 1.5 hours)

Morning:

Begin your day with a rejuvenating yoga session amidst the tranquil surroundings of Chikmagalur. Welcome the first rays of sunlight as you practice yoga and meditation by a serene lake, harmonizing your mind, body, and spirit.

Afternoon:

Visit the picturesque Bhadra Dam, where you can enjoy a serene boat ride amidst the placid waters surrounded by lush forests. Revel in the picturesque landscapes and spot avian species in their natural habitat.

Evening:

Conclude your trip with a visit to a charming tea estate, where you can stroll through the sprawling plantations, interact with local tea farmers, and relish aromatic cups of freshly brewed tea while soaking in the tranquil ambiance.
